Establishing a Perennial Paradise

Embrace the magic of a garden that blooms year after year. A perennial paradise is not just a collection of plants; it's a vibrant tapestry woven with carefully chosen species that return season after season, offering a consistent display of color and texture. By choosing the right species, you can create a thriving landscape that requires minimal upkeep while providing maximum beauty.

Start your journey by assessing your garden's conditions. Consider factors like sunlight exposure, soil type, and rainfall to pinpoint the ideal perennials for your region.

Showcase the benefits of a perennial paradise:

  • Low maintenance
  • Vibrant blooms throughout the year
  • Biodiversity support
  • Economical in the long run

With a little forethought, you can revitalize your garden into a perennial haven that brings joy for years to come.

The Timeless Allure of Perennials

Perennials captivate gardeners with their vibrant colors and stunning forms. Unlike annuals, which wither after a single year, perennials return year after year, delivering lasting display of beauty. Their rhizomes run deep into the earth, supplying them with sustenance.

Perennials flourish in a spectrum of conditions, from open locations to shaded areas. They complement any garden design, regardless it's a structured landscape or a wildflower meadow.
